They were included in D&H's 1978 mass sale of six-axle ALCo, EMD and GE units to dealer Diesel Supply International, who immediately leased them to Mexico. I don't recall if it was a "lease/purchase" arrangement, but none of the units were intended to be returned to the USA.
One of the C-628s, ex-D&H 605 I think, is (as of a year or so ago) in a railroad museum in Yucatan, and one of the SD45s, which was one of the three (of the four) ex-EMD demonstrators D&H bought, was reported to be retired but still mostly intact a few years ago.
